Commons was blocked in my college too. All it took for me to get it unblocked was a 25 min conversation with Head of IT dept. She did the needful to unblock Commons. Suggest talking to the college's/cyber cafe's network administrator first to unblocking websites.

and I don't think chapters should have a say on things like these, especially when they put a big disclaimer "We are not responsible for content", they loose the right to talk as chapter.
Say what? There two separate things here.
- Chapter's are indeed not responsible for content - that holds true
for *everyone* except the people who post content. 2. That a Chapter is not responsible for content, by design, does not mean they lose any right to speak as a Chapter or otherwise especially with respect to things a community can take a stand about - the personal image filter being one of them. A Chapter that is the voice of a community can do many things with respect to content.
I don't see the two positions as being immiscible.
